The term 'biodegradable' on packaging suggests environmental friendliness, but the reality is complex. Biodegradation depends heavily on environmental conditions like temperature, moisture, and microbial presence, meaning a material's breakdown rate varies significantly by location. A product designed to degrade in an industrial composting facility, for instance, might persist for years in a landfill or ocean.
Standards exist to test biodegradability under specific simulated conditions, such as industrial composting or home composting. However, materials certified for one environment may not perform as expected in another, leading to potential confusion and pollution if disposed of incorrectly. For example, PLA, often seen as a green alternative, breaks down rapidly in industrial composters but much slower in less controlled settings.
Understanding the nuances of biodegradability is crucial for consumers to make informed choices about packaging disposal and to avoid contributing to environmental pollution.
